First Look: Festival Gone Moody

Romper: Mossimo
Swimwear: Xhilaration

I’m obsessed with the lace-up detail and the bell sleeve of the Mossimo romper. I layered an Xhilaration push-up bikini top underneath my Mossimo romper. Both items are super cool and affordable. This look adds more of a rock-n-roll feel to traditional boho festival looks. You girls can also layer different pieces to create a goth-chic festival look. I completed this look with black ankle booties, festival-style earrings and fringe clutches. I would totally rock this look at music festivals. 

Second Look: Festival Gone Decorated

Dress: Xhilaration (similar here
Swimwear: Mossimo

If you love colors and prints, then the second look is for you. I layered a Mossimo cut-out halter one-piece swimsuit underneath my Xhilaration dress. The swimsuit and my dress have pretty and very different prints, yet it’s still so fun to layer them together. It’s all about experimenting, and you will find certain things go surprisingly well together more so than you would have thought. :P BTW, there are also many other cool prints available. It’s a great look that you can just stay at home or travel somewhere in. 

For these two looks, you girls can also swap the swimwear underneath. They will go with the dress and rompers very well too. Besides what I have picked, Xhilaration and Mossimo have a wide-ranging selection of different festival pieces with laser-cut, macramé and pastel colors.
